Description
Japanese version of Mahjong for children.
Goal of the game is to collect 3 sets of 4 tiles, and say Punch!
Tiles have pictures of animals.
Later versions Ponjan/Pom Jong (by Anoa, later trademark of Tomy) and Donjara (by Bandai) the goal was to collect 3 sets of 3 tiles. Games have minor differences in how points are counted, but essentially the rules are same. New versions usually have pictures of animation characters, but there are other versions like one with girls from idol group AKB48.
